Essential Functions and Responsibilities

This position will serve as a Roving Manager, providing support to a variety of properties and special projects. Utilizes proven skills and knowledge to readily adapt to the challenges that accompany supporting different communities, as assigned. Each day will be unique, requiring an ability to prioritize, multitask, think creatively, take initiative, and employ a diverse set of skills. While covering properties, the Roving Community Manager is responsible for all community operations and team member management, providing superior customer service to residents.

Essential Duties: 

1. Assist with special projects such as, but not limited to, due diligence and set up of new acquisitions, lease-up of new developments, and training of new hire/ newly promoted employees.*

2. Cover Community Manager positions as assigned.*

3. Manage community activities, including oversight of maintenance, management, and leasing teams.*

4. Effective marketing of the apartment community including successful relationship building with local businesses and corporate outreach.

5. Financial reporting, including owner reports and budget creation.*

6. Frequent communication with teams and management.

7. Oversee the day-to-day financial, sales, marketing, maintenance, and administrative operations of the community.*

8. Maintain the highest level of customer service for prospects, residents, vendors, and corporate departments.*

9. Manage financial performance and remain current on market conditions.

10. Comply with company standards as defined by Cascade Management Inc.'s Policies and Procedures and applicable laws, e.g., Fair Housing, Landlord Tenant, Local Building Codes, and OSHA.*

11. Perform other duties as assigned.

12. Regular and reliable attendance during scheduled hours*
